FC Porto's squad consists of 27 players. Goalkeepers: Claudio Ramos (Portugal), Andorinha (Portugal), Diogo Costa (Portugal). Defenders: Thiago Silva (Brazil), Jakub Kiwior (Poland), Jan Bednarek (Poland), Zaidu Sanusi (Nigeria), Nehuén Pérez (Argentina), Alberto Costa (Portugal), Dominik Prpic (Croatia), Martim Fernandes (Portugal), Francisco Moura (Portugal). Midfielders: Victor Froholdt (Denmark), Gabriel Veiga (Spain), Pablo Rosario (Dominican Republic), Alan Varela (Argentina), Seko Fofana (Ivory Coast), Rodrigo Mora (Portugal). Forwards: William Gomes (Brazil), Samuel Aghehowa (Spain), Pepe (Brazil), Borja Sainz (Spain), Luuk de Jong (Netherlands), Deniz Gül (Turkiye), Terem Moffi (Nigeria), Yann Karamoh (France), Oskar Pietuszewski (Poland).

FC Porto transfers: New signings include Seko Fofana (from Rennes), Terem Moffi (from Nice), Oskar Pietuszewski (from Jagiellonia Bialystok), Thiago Silva (from Free agent), Yann Karamoh (from Torino) and 12 more. Players transferred out include Tomas Perez (to Atletico MG), Stephen Eustaquio (to LAFC), Ángel Alarcon (to FC Utrecht), Gabriel Veron (to Nacional), Andre Franco (to Chicago) and 15 more.

Francesco Farioli is the current head coach of FC Porto. Under their leadership, the team has achieved a 87% win rate across 23 matches, averaging 2.70 points per game.

Notable previous managers include Vitor Bruno managed the club for one season, recording 13 wins from 18 matches (72% win rate). Jose Tavares managed the club for one season, recording 0 wins from 1 match (0% win rate). Other former coaches include Martin Anselmi, Sergio Conceicao, Nuno Espirito Santo, Julen Lopetegui, Jose Peseiro, Paulo Fonseca, Luis Castro, and Vitor Pereira.
